Medicare Enrollment Periods: The Timing Rules That Can Change Your Options
Medicare decisions are not only about what plan you want. They are also about when you are allowed to enroll, switch, or make changes. Missing the right window can affect your choices, your effective date, and in some situations your long-term costs.
The same Medicare choice can feel easy or difficult depending on the window
People often focus on comparing plans and only later realize that enrollment timing changes what they are actually allowed to do.
Because different Medicare products follow different rules, timing matters on multiple levels. The best plan on paper does not help if the enrollment window has already closed.
